GG100GGC Girl Guiding Caernarfonshire Special Event Station

10/05/2010
| No Comments
| News

Saturday 15th May saw NWRS members at Felin Bach, Caeathro, Caernarfon where we ran a special event station for Caernarfonshire Girl Guides at thier summer county camp. The activities started at 2pm and ran through to around 5.30pm. Ofcom granted the callsign GG100GGC, GGC marking Girl Guiding Caernarfonshire. We ran 2 HF ssb stations, one using 2 […]

RSGB 2m Contest

08/05/2010
| No Comments
| News

On Tuesday 4th May, NWRS equipment officer Karl Ltham MW6CSS travelled to a summit near Llangollen with his Yaesu 857 and a 4ele beam. Karl was soon on the air and racking up contacts on SSB. By 8pm he had worked G8JGO/P in IO93GI @ 121km, G0EHV in IO84XT @ 221km and G0XDI/P in JO01KJ @323km. […]
